The average University of Phoenix Senior Developer earns an estimated $124,602 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$107,098 with a $17,504 bonus. University of Phoenix's Senior Developer compensation is $12,999 less than the US average for a Senior Developer. Senior Developer salaries at University of Phoenix can range from $52,000 - $246,000.
